Output 430839fdfc114d2ec2f96f77deafb4c47f6e780a5c57c821d48864a0b43c9301:22

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 754386945f6c602b43079cd6fef64d9312eec22e OP_EQUAL
address
3CP3sko7hq14m8BpzL71W7QSNG8BYgbEEK
transaction
430839fdfc114d2ec2f96f77deafb4c47f6e780a5c57c821d48864a0b43c9301
spent
true